Comparison of Macro Methods

This is a series of close-focused shots. Those made with the Sigma 105mm are shot with a true macro lens. One is at 1:4 magnification and the second at 1:2. Those following were all shot with a Zuiko 17.5-45mm (kit) zoom lens at 45mm. I used a set of Hoya close-up lenses: +1, +2, both together for +3, then with a +4 added to make a +7. The magnifications ranged from 1:7 to 1:38 using the Hoya close-up lenses. These are easily determined by the image of the mm scale, and knowing that the Olympus 4/3rds sensor has a width of 17.3mm. The last two were shot using the "macro" component of a wide-angle accessory lens and the magnification is 1:1.73. In visual comparison of quality, I am amazed to see essentially the same quality with either method.
